How much does it cost to rent a home in Travis Northeast?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Travis Northeast 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,389 | $1,329 | $1,450 |
| Travis Northeast 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,080 | $1,700 | $2,750 |
| Travis Northeast 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,406 | $1,800 | $3,750 |
| Travis Northeast 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,648 | $2,350 | $2,799 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Travis Northeast
What type of rentals are currently available in Travis Northeast?
There are currently 21 Apartments for Rent in Travis Northeast, TX with pricing that ranges from $881 to $3,265. There are also 131 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Travis Northeast ranging from $925 to $3,750.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Travis Northeast?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Travis Northeast ranges from $925 to $3,750 with an average monthly rent of $1,889.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Travis Northeast?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Travis Northeast range from $1,906 to $3,265,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,700 to $2,750.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,800 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,025.
